Here is how to be an Achiever
What does success mean to you, if I may ask? Whatever it is, soon or later you will realise that if you want success, you have to take action and go for it.
Being action oriented and results focused will do a lot to keep you on track in your path to achieving your well desired and deserved goals.
The bottom line is that, you are responsible for the results you achieve in life. Not the government, not your parents, not your friends, not your mother in law. No, none of them. YOU are responsible. You are the common denominator to both your triumphs and your mess-up’s.
Day in and day out, a lot of people realise their dreams while yet a lot shatter theirs. The gift of 'today' is a great gift. The truth is every day is the perfect day to do the right thing, to pursue your dreams, to take action, to begin.
Brian Tracy truly encapsulates this notion of the achiever in his piece of writing; “10 steps to Success”. I will quote them here for you.
“1. Start by clarifying the dream. Dream it big, dream it often, and always in living colour! Imagine the problems, the benefits, the skills you’ll need the people you’ll meet along the way. Dream often and dream the details.
2. Create a plan. What will your dream cost? How will it work? How long will it take? Who will help you get there? How will you solve the challenges, overcome the obstacles, and become the person you’ll need to become to reach your goal?
3. Reach out. We live in an amazing time. You can write, phone, fax, or email just about anyone on earth! Consult with experts. Talk to people who have achieved whatever you want to achieve. Truly successful people are usually delighted to show others the way. Make the calls.
4 Tell others. There is no substitute for talking about your dreams. Saying the words makes them powerful. Talk about where you want to go, what you want to do, and who you will become. And as a benefit, you will discover people who will help you along the way.
5. Take action. No matter what your dream, there is a step you can take today. If you are serious, there is someone you can call or write to. There is a book you can read, or some action that will start you on the path. Steven Spielberg snuck into movie lots as a teenager, just to look around. What action will you take today?
6. Set deadlines. Set deadlines for each of your small/big, personal/official, long-term/short-term task AND always try to finish the task by that deadline.
7. Eliminate distractions. This is the tough one, and a favourite excuse of the “almost successful”. Successful people eliminate the distractions of life. Combine errands, delegate tasks, hire people to do things you don’t want to do. Simplify your life and never waste time. Turn off the TV (and some time also the computer)
8. Invest wisely. Successful people understand that their dreams will require an investment of time or money or energy and they are prepared to pay the price. Whatever your dream, it will require some risk, and some investment. Make the investment.
9. Create room for success. All of us are doing something every moment of every day, and making your dreams come true will require some adjustments. Whether it’s adjusting your schedule, your finances, or your use of energy, you’ll have to make room for success.
10. Have a mentor/coach. Whether you hire a professional coach or find a local expert, or a cyber friend. Successful people have coaches. There are very few “self made” successes! We all need someone to believe in us, someone to encourage, challenge and applaud us. Develop a close, working relationship with a coach who can show you the way to your dreams!
Success is no accident. Success is always the result of our best efforts. It is the result of investing”.

Here is how to improve your Finances
There is an old saying that goes like these: “The only thing easy about money is losing it”
In other words, making money is hard and requires a lot of effort but loosing it, well not much effort is required, just spend , spend & spend some more and in no time, it’s all gone just like that.
You make money by doing more of certain things, less of other things, starting something brand new and stopping doing certain things altogether.
It requires clarity, discipline, tenacity, persistence and resourcefulness. If you are to make more or improve your finances you have to do something different from what you are doing today because:”The more you do of what you are doing, the more you will get of what you’ve got.
One of your financial goals should be to make the best use of your time in all that you do. You should continually think about the value of your time and deploy it in use at those activities that are most resourceful.
And here are four ways to demonstrate that.
1. You can do more of certain things.
What are the things you should do more of? Well, Of course you should do more of those things that are working best for you.
For example, if you are a sole trader or small business owner, you should use more of the marketing and sales methods that are getting you face to face with your best customers, the ones who buy the most readily, pay in time and appreciate the value of your products and services.
Do more of those things that are working for you and keep improving on them. That is the key.
2. You can do less of other things.
Don’t fall into the habit of doing things just because you are comfortable doing them even if these things are not working particularly well for you. This will terribly waste your time and leave you frustrated at the end.
You should do less and less of those things of low value that are giving you few results, so that you can have more time to do more of higher value things that are giving you better results. You can’t do both at the same time.
3. You can start something brand new.
Be creative, innovative and ‘think outside the box’. Don’t be particularly stuck with the same old boring and low value things and activities.
You should try to learn and apply new ideas.
Make up your mind not to be limited by anything. Explore your territory and discover new and better ways to do your work, business, etc.
A simple idea that you might open your mind to through continuous study, creativity, innovation might make all the difference in your finances and especially in your life.
4. You can stop certain things altogether.
Resourceful people are always open to the possibility of, and the need for, doing something completely different. They are willing to stop doing anything that they recognise is not working and is eating up on their time. They don’t get stuck in their “comfort zone” and stay there just because it feels good. No, they are willing and ready to take the risks that go with embarking on a new course of action.
Now, given the above four points, here is a question for you:
Is there anything in your life – right now – that you should do more of, less of, start or stop doing?
I am sure you know the answer. Act on it and keep asking the above question every day if you want to maintain peak performance and improve your finances.
